Tunis, May 20, 2022 (LANA) - The Tunisian Lines Express Company announced the re-operation of its regular air route between Djerba and Tripoli, starting from next June 2, with an average of two flights per week on Thursday and Sunday of each week. The company stated in a press release that the flight times were carefully studied to match the times of other flights it provides to Tunis or to other international destinations such as Malta, Palermo and Naples to enable travelers to continue their flights to their destinations... Tripoli, May 20, 2022 (LANA) - The Chief Justice of the Supreme Court, Counselor Mohamed Al-Hafi, participated last Tuesday in the meetings of the heads of Arab and African courts in Cairo, during which an agreement was signed to establish the Union of Supreme Administrative Courts and African State Councils.
